Power Distribution Companies

Securing Power Purchase Agreements (PPAs) with power distribution companies (DISCOMs) was essential for Ind-Barath Power Infra. These agreements guaranteed a steady revenue stream by ensuring the sale of generated electricity. However, the financial instability within India's DISCOMs significantly impacted the bankability of thermal PPAs. This situation created challenges for the company.

  • As of 2024, DISCOMs' outstanding dues to power generators exceeded ₹1.3 lakh crore.
  • The average cost of power purchase for DISCOMs increased by 10-15% in 2023-24.
  • Many PPAs faced renegotiation or delays due to DISCOMs' financial constraints.
  • The Ministry of Power initiated measures to improve DISCOMs' financial health in 2024.

Fuel Procurement

Fuel procurement, particularly coal, was crucial for Ind-Barath Power Infra's thermal power plants. This involved sourcing coal from various suppliers, negotiating favorable prices, and efficiently managing inventory levels to ensure continuous operations. The ability to secure a stable and cost-effective fuel supply directly impacted the profitability of the power generation business. Effective fuel management was essential for maintaining operational efficiency and competitive pricing in the energy market.

  • In 2024, coal prices fluctuated significantly, impacting power plant operational costs.
  • Negotiating long-term supply contracts was vital for price stability.
  • Inventory management minimized disruptions and optimized fuel costs.
  • The company focused on diversifying its coal sources to mitigate supply risks.

Icon

Debt Service

Debt service, encompassing interest payments and principal repayments, was a substantial cost component for Ind-Barath Power Infra. The company's financial struggles, culminating in insolvency, amplified the strain of debt service. Effective debt management was crucial for maintaining financial stability, particularly amidst operational challenges and market volatility. Ind-Barath's situation underscores the critical need for robust financial planning and prudent debt management strategies in the power sector.

  • Interest expenses often represented a significant portion of the operating costs.
  • Insolvency proceedings can lead to restructuring of debt obligations.
  • Debt restructuring can include negotiating lower interest rates.
  • The power sector requires substantial capital investment, often funded by debt.

Icon

Capacity Payments

Ind-Barath Power Infra secured capacity payments from distribution companies. These payments ensured a consistent revenue stream. They compensated for maintaining electricity generation capacity. This provided predictability, crucial for financial planning. For example, in 2024, such payments were crucial for some power producers.
